Hot Beverages

204 products

£16.22 – £21.00

In stock

£16.90

In stock

In stock

£16.90
£13.59

In stock

In stock

£13.59
£11.80

In stock

In stock

£11.80
£50.44

In stock

In stock

£50.44
£31.22 – £37.68

In stock

£16.19

In stock

In stock

£16.19
£13.79

In stock

In stock

£13.79
£54.04

In stock

In stock

£54.04
£27.29

In stock

In stock

£27.29
£32.68

In stock

In stock

£32.68
£21.47

In stock

In stock

£21.47
£24.28

In stock

In stock

£24.28
£36.06

In stock

In stock

£36.06
£37.90

In stock

In stock

£37.90
£18.18

In stock

In stock

£18.18
£11.56

In stock

In stock

£11.56
£11.56

In stock

In stock

£11.56
£25.33

In stock

In stock

£25.33
£11.87

In stock

In stock

£11.87
Shopping cart

Your cart is empty.

Return to shop
close